2016-01-07 23 views
0

我是Android應用程序開發的新手,我在Android應用程序中使用圖標時遇到問題。我必須在我的Android應用程序中使用近20個圖標。爲此,我需要將20個單獨的圖標PNG文件放在可繪製文件夾下。或者,是否有可能將所有20個圖標合併爲一個PNG文件(圖片精靈)作爲圖標集,並將該單個PNG文件放置在可繪製文件夾中?如果我們可以這樣做,有人可以提供一些關於如何做到這一點並在應用程序中提到的指針。謝謝。在Android應用程序中使用多個圖標

+0

[使用圖像的可能的複製精靈在Android](http:// stackoverflow .COM /問題/ 5732943 /使用圖像 - 精靈上,機器人) –

回答

1

試圖把所有可繪製文件夾的個別圖標PNG文件,它可以很容易地設計所有不同大小的設備。

0

在編寫遊戲時使用sprite更好。如果您將精靈用作紋理,那麼您只需將紋理寫入內存一次。

我認爲在你的情況下精靈是一個壞主意。考慮爲每個精靈提供不同的像素密度:當精靈需要在具有更多像素的設備上顯示時,您如何提供圖像邊界?

考慮爲什麼你想這樣做的第一個地方。 Android Studio中已經有一個圖像導入功能,可以幫助您將單個PNG轉換爲多個像素密度。

0

創建不同的可繪製文件夾並將相應的圖像文件保存到該文件夾​​中。

  1. 繪製,LDPI
  2. 繪製,華電國際
  3. 繪製-xhdpi
  4. 繪製-xxhdpi

OR

更多details

相關問題